The Price of Defeat in Iran
Donald Trump's Iran deal commits the U.S. and regional partners to providing Iran with $300 billion for economic development, compared to the Marshall Plan's $13 billion for postwar Europe. The vague memorandum includes Iran's pledge not to build nuclear weapons and to downblend enriched uranium, but lacks details on enrichment limits and future Strait of Hormuz tolls. Sanctions relief will occur in stages, starting with oil exports and frozen asset releases.
